The miR-147b-3p/NDUFA4 axis regulates the osteogenic differentiation in MC3T3-E1 cells. (A)The transfection efficiency of p-NDUFA4 was detected by qRT-PCR. Subsequently, co-transfection of NDUFA4 overexpression (p-NDUFA4) and miR-147b-3p mimic was performed in MC3T3-E1 cells. Western blotting analysis (B,C) revealed expression levels of NDUFA4 protein, while cell viability was assessed using the CCK-8(D).Then, MC3T3-E1 cells were co-transfected with p-NDUFA4 and miR-147b-3p mimic and induced for osteogenic differentiation for 14 days. Alizarin red staining (E,F) allowed observation of mineralized nodule formation during osteogenesis induction.Western blotting analysis of osteogenic induction demonstrated levels of ALP and Runx2 proteins (G,H). Data were presented as mean ± SD. *P < 0.05, **P < 0.01, ***P < 0.001 compared to NC, ##P < 0.01 compared to NC
